Wednesday, Feb. 20 8:41am ET Expos sign Canseco to minor league contract MONTREAL (Ticker) -- Jose Canseco will have a chance to pursue his dream of 500 home runs but to do it he will have to show he can play the field. The 37-year-old Canseco, who spent last season with the Chicago White Sox, on Tuesday signed a minor league contract with the Montreal Expos. Canseco batted .258 with 16 homers and 49 RBI in 76 games last season. But Canseco has been relgated to designated hitter for most of the last decade and will have to play the field in the National League. Canseco, who may fit into Montreal's left field plans, is a 17-year veteran who will be playing full-time in the NL for the first time. He broke in with Oakland in 1985 and has spent time with Texas, Boston, Toronto, Tampa Bay and the New York Yankees. |
